我在csv文件中有1个数据集,其中包含2列。它们是类似的属性(此数据集在0 NF中)。现在我在mySQL中创建了新的模式,我只为该属性分配了一列。我的问题是我想将旧数据从csv文件导入到新模式。我知道我们可以使用LOAD DATA INFILE命令导入数据,但是我可以通过任何方式从单列中的2列加载数据。
为了更好地理解,我在下面给出了示例模式。
orignal table attributes(csv file):
Adm_id,SSN,Diagnosis,Medicine1,Medicine2。
新表:
adm_id,SSN,诊断,医学。
问题:如何从旧的csv文件中加载上述模式中的药物列中的数据。
解释: 这是一种不同的情况。在跳过列中,我们不考虑该列中的数据。但是在这里,我需要在csv文件中从1行生成2个单独的行,其中每行在新表的Medicine列中具有顺序药1和药2值